Melbourne, CBD: Two men charged after alleged ‘targeted’ shooting leaves 26yo dead

Two men have been charged with murder after a 26-year-old was shot dead in Melbourne’s CBD earlier this month.
The Seaford man was gunned down on a city street about 3.40am on Sunday, September 7. He was rushed to the hospital with upper body injuries but died soon after.
Police allege the shooting was a targeted attack, involving a group of men known to the victim.

Following interviews, a 23-year-old Doveton man and a 22-year-old Clyde man were charged with murder. They were refused bail and are due to face the Melbourne Magistrates’ Court on Thursday.
A 22-year-old Pakenham man and a 23-year-old Keysborough man were released without charge, with police saying inquiries are continuing.
